Product Info for Pulsar Telos XP50 2.5-10x50mm Thermal Monocular

Specifications for Pulsar Telos XP50 2.5-10x50mm Thermal Monocular:
Manufacturer:
Pulsar
Magnification:
2.5 - 10 x
Color:
Black
Resolution:
640x480 pixels
Field of View, Angle:
12.4 - 9.3 degrees
Objective Lens Diameter:
50 mm
Length:
11.14 in
Battery Life:
8 hours
Battery Type:
Lithium Ion
Weight:
0.72 kg
Water Resistance Level:
IPX-7
Refresh Rate:
50 Hz
Operating Temperature:
-25 - 40 Celsius
Range of Detection:
1800 m
Noise Equivalent Temperature Difference:
18 mK NETD
Memory:
64 GB
Dimensions:
238x72x90 mm
Body Material:
Rubber Armored Reinforced Plastic
Frequency Band:
2.4 / 5 GHz
Connectivity:
Wi-Fi
Media Format:
.mp4 / .jpg
Accuracy:
+-1 m
Wavelength:
905 nm
Focus Range:
1800 m
Display Type:
AMOLED
Magnification Type:
Variable
Features of Pulsar Telos XP50 2.5-10x50mm Thermal Monocular
Highly sensitive thermal imaging sensor with NETD <18mK ensures stunning thermal image quality and perfect detail recognition even in the hardest weather conditions, when thermal contrast is low. The smallest temperature differences will be clearly visible during the rainfall, fog or cold mornings, in the most difficult conditions for thermal imager.
You can ideally adjust the image in Telos with one hand - the focusing and smooth zoom rings are located on the lens in the classic layout, one by one, as in professional camera objective lenses. The consistent arrangement of the rings enables getting a clear image with the required magnification quickly and with minimal effort.
Understanding the target distance is an essential factor in making the right decisions. A built-in laser rangefinder with a range of up to 1 kilometre allows you to measure distances in single measurements and continuous scanning modes with an accuracy of 1 metre for quick and error-free assessment of the situation.
Telos thermal imaging devices have been designed for use in the tough outdoors using and in the temperature range of -25 to +40 C. The device is waterproof when fully immersed in water. The composite polymeric rubber-coated case possesses high operational qualities. The absence of protruding parts in the design, as well as the anatomically optimal housing shape of the Telos thermal imaging devices contribute to safety and comfort during prolonged use time.
The brand-new LPS 7i quick-change Li-ion battery guarantees more than 8 hours of operating time. LPS 7i doesn't require special chargers - just connect it to any network adapter via the USB Type-C port and charge it using the Power Delivery fast charging protocol in a short time. Moreover, the LPS 7i battery supports wireless charging.
The rubber-coated housing helps to securely hold the thermal imaging device in the hand in both dry weather and rain. The housing has exceptional wear resistance and perfectly withstands operation in a wide range of temperatures, including dusty and moist conditions, and it protects the device from falls. In addition, the housing is easily cleaned and keeps its original appearance for a long time.

Telos thermal monoculars are characterized by advanced functionality, but determining the priority of a particular function is the privilege of the user, who sets the order of items in the device menu.
Use the brightness and contrast adjustments to maximise the detail and informative value of the image in specific observation conditions. The User Mode function saves selected brightness and contrast settings in the device's memory providing optimal image quality for the next use of the thermal imager immediately, with no additional adjustments needed.
